Question: A hot-air balloon is sinking toward the ground at a speed of 3.05 m/s, when the pilot drops a couple of sandbags overboard. The balloon immediately begins to experience constant acceleration, such that it slows in its descent, stops for an instant, and begins to rise. 24.8 s after dropping the sandbags, the balloon re-attains its original altitude.

Part A: How long did it take for the balloon to reach its minimum altitude?

Part B: How far did the balloon fall during that time?

Part C: What is the speed of the balloon when it returns to the original altitude?
